Impact

If enacted, SF4880 would directly influence the state's sales tax laws by creating a temporary exemption that deviates from the standard tax framework established in Minnesota Statutes. This holiday is expected to stimulate economic activity as residents take advantage of the opportunity to purchase goods without the added sales tax burden. However, it could also impact state revenue temporarily as the exemption will lead to a decrease in tax collections during July 2026. The bill reflects a broader trend of leveraging sales tax holidays to boost economic engagement and support local businesses.

Summary

SF4880 proposes a temporary sales tax holiday in Minnesota, set to occur in July 2026. This initiative marks the 250th anniversary of the United States and aims to exempt the retail sale of tangible personal property from sales tax during this month. The exemption is framed as a celebration of historical significance while also providing financial relief to consumers during a peak shopping season. By eliminating tax on certain purchases, the bill intends to encourage consumer spending, benefiting retailers and the local economy.
